325. Deputy Dara Calleary asked the Minister for Jobs, Enterprise and Innovation in the context of Industrial Development Agency’s Horizon 2020 strategy, and the target of locating 50% of investments outside Dublin and Cork, if he will provide a breakdown of the number of the agency's sponsored visits to Dublin, which also visited Cork; and the number of the agency's sponsored visits to Cork, which also visited Dublin, since 2012. [34688/15]
